分类 工具 下的文章

IdeaKeyBinding 是 Cursor IDE 的一个实用插件,它允许用户将快捷键绑定从 IntelliJ IDEA/WebStorm 等 JetBrains 产品迁移到 Cursor 中,帮助习惯 JetBrains 系列 IDE 的用户更平滑地过渡到 Cursor。

Cursor idea key

主要功能
快捷键映射:将 IntelliJ IDEA 的常用快捷键映射到 Cursor 的对应操作

自定义配置:允许用户自定义或调整不完美的映射

操作兼容:支持常见操作如代码补全、重构、导航等的快捷键映射

安装方法
在 Cursor 中打开命令面板 (Ctrl+Shift+P 或 Cmd+Shift+P)

搜索 "Extensions: Install Extension"

查找 "IdeaKeyBinding" 并安装

使用建议
安装后可能需要重启 Cursor 使插件生效

如果某些快捷键冲突或不工作,可以通过 Cursor 的快捷键设置进行调整

该插件特别适合从 WebStorm/PyCharm/IntelliJ 迁移到 Cursor 的开发者

注意事项
由于 Cursor 和 IntelliJ 的底层架构不同,并非所有 IDEA 的快捷键都能完美映射,但该插件覆盖了大多数常用开发场景的快捷键需求。

这个插件可以显著减少从 JetBrains IDE 切换到 Cursor 的学习曲线,让开发者更专注于编码而不是重新记忆快捷键。

8 月 1 日消息,Mozilla 于今天正式发布火狐浏览器 Firefox 116 版本更新,官方目前并未公布完整更新日志,不过用户可以访问服务器下载新版本。

下载地址:https://ftp.mozilla.org/pub/firefox/releases/116.0/

Firefox 116 主要为画中画模式引入了音量滑块、改善了 Ctrl-Shift-T 快捷组合键、改善了 HTTP / 2 上传功能等。

新版本不再支持 Win7、Win8 以及 Win8.1,也不再支持 macOS 10.14、10.13 和 10.12。

如果仍运行上述版本的 Windows 和 macOS 用户,可以尝试使用 Firefox ESR 版本,该浏览器版本将持续支持到 2024 年 9 月。

Firefox 116 和 Firefox 115.1 ESR 的正式发布日期为 2023 年 8 月 1 日。由于内置的更新系统,大多数浏览器安装将自动升级到新版本。

Firefox 116 新功能改进:
调整 Ctrl-Shift-T 组合键
在 Firefox 中,键盘快捷键 Ctrl-Shift-T 默认重新打开上一个关闭的选项卡,如果没有要重新打开的选项卡,则重新打开上一个会话。

而自 Firefox 116 版本开始,该键盘快捷键现在也支持重新打开浏览器窗口。

新的逻辑重新打开上次关闭的选项卡或浏览器窗口,如果没有更多的选项卡或窗口要重新打开,则重新打开上一个浏览会话。

画中画支持音量滑块
Firefox 的画中画模式现在支持音量滑块,以便更容易地改变音量。

Linux 版本支持仅 Wayland 选项
Linux Firefox 116 稳定版允许用户选择 Wayland-only 和 X11-only。

小任班长 7 月 27 日消息,开发者 Pete Batard 今天发布了 Rufus 4.2 稳定版更新,本次更新并未引入重磅新功能 / 新特性,但改进了此前版本中存在的诸多 BUG,并优化了运行性能。

Rufus 4.2 稳定版主要支持 ZIP64,允许提取大于 4GB 的镜像;此外还支持 VHDX 和 FFU 镜像格式备份和还原当前磁盘。

小任班长在此附上 Rufus 4.2 稳定版更新内容如下:

Rufus 是一个可以帮助格式化和创建可引导 U 盘的工具,可以制作 Windows、Linux、Android-x86 等操作系统的启动盘。最新发布的 4.2 版现在可从 GitHub 下载。

1. JSAPI或JSSDK调起微信支付,接入小程序支付非常相似,以下是三种接入方式的对比:

微信支付

注意:小程序不能通过拉起H5页面做jsapi支付,小程序内只能使用小程序支付。

小程序不需要支付目录和授权域名配置。

对比链接:
https://pay.weixin.qq.com/wiki/doc/api/wxa/wxa_sl_api.php?chapter=7_3&index=1

服务商模式下的appid指的是:服务商商户号绑定的服务商appid,一般情况是认证的服务号appid

1.1普通模式

最常规的普通模式,适用于有自己开发团队或外包开发商的直连商户收款。开发者申请自己的appid和mch_id,两者需具备绑定关系,以此来使用微信支付提供的开放接口,对用户提供服务。

1.2服务商模式

第三方服务商申请自己的服务号appid,并通过该服务号appid申请服务商mch_id,以此获得微信支付服务商能力。再通过服务商mch_id为所服务的特约商户申请创建微信支付sub_mch_id,创建好的sub_mch_id默认和服务商的mch_id建立父子授权关系。

2.微信小程序支付,服务商模式支付,名词解释

appid为和服务商商户号绑定的服务商appid,一般情况为认证的服务号appid;

mch_id为服务商商户号,目前仅在认证服务号后台(mp.weixin.qq.com)开放申请服务商商户号,申请开通后即在微信支付系统创建绑定关系;

sub_mch_id为和服务商商户号有父子绑定关系的子商户号;

sub_appid为服务商模式的场景appid,在小程序中拉起支付时该字段必传;

trade_type请填写JSAPI;

openid为appid对应的微信用户标识;

sub_openid为sub_appid对应的微信用户标识,小程序服务商模式下单中的openid和sub_openid必须至少传其中一个,在小程序中拉起支付一般情况下只能获取到sub_openid,即使用wx.login接口获得的openid

免责声明
本博客部分内容来自于互联网,不代表作者的观点和立场,如若侵犯到您的权益,请联系[email protected]。我们会在24小时内进行删除。